What is Terex's accrued manufacturing costs?
Terex (TEX) reported accrued manufacturing costs of $168M in Q1 2026.
How has Terex's accrued manufacturing costs changed year-over-year?
Terex's accrued manufacturing costs increased by 43.6% year-over-year, from $117M to $168M.
What is the long-term trend for Terex's accrued manufacturing costs?
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), Terex's accrued manufacturing costs has grown at a 7.5%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$85.8M to $123M.
